Consider a stock trading platform built using a microservices architecture. The platform allows users to place orders, execute trades, update account balances, and notify users of trade statuses. Each of these functions is handled by different microservices.
Describe how you would use the Saga pattern to ensure data consistency and reliable transactions across these microservices, especially in scenarios where one or more of the services might fail during a trade execution process. How would you handle potential rollbacks and compensating transactions? Marks
